The AXTMG team eliminated before the major PMWC 2025 finals. The PUBG Mobile World Cup survival stadium is now over.

In a dramatic turn of events at the PUBG Mobile World Cup 2025, Team AxTMG’s campaign has come to an unexpected halt during the Survival Stage. Despite a valiant effort in their last match, AxTMG could not secure a spot in the top 8, effectively ending their journey ahead of the much-anticipated PMWC 2025 Grand Finals.

Team AxTMG Couldn’t make it to the PMWC 2025 Grand Finals

For AxTMG, hopes were high throughout the tournament, with fans rallying behind the squad as they navigated a fiercely competitive field. Entering the Survival Stage, all eyes were on whether the team could produce a last-minute resurgence to keep their championship dreams alive. However, even before the dust settled on the final match, it became mathematically impossible for AxTMG to clinch a top-8 position—a threshold required to advance to PMWC 2025 grand finals.
